Are you ready to whip up some vegetarian dishes that are not only delicious but also packed with protein? Whether you’re a dedicated herbivore or just looking to add more plant-based meals to your planner, these high protein vegetarian meals are sure to satisfy your cravings for greens – and keep you feeling fueled at the same time.

Find culinary inspiration on our blog


First things first, let’s talk protein. While it’s true that meat is a common source of protein, many veggie lovers know that there are plenty of plant-based options that pack a powerful protein punch. From beans and lentils to tofu and tempeh, the possibilities are endless. Incorporating high-protein vegetarian meals into your diet can help you meet your daily protein needs while also providing a wide range of vitamins, minerals, and antioxidants that are vital for overall health and well-being. So, let’s dive in!

1. Quinoa Stuffed Bell Peppers

Looking for a healthy and satisfying meal that’s as beautiful as it is delicious? These quinoa stuffed bell peppers fit the bill perfectly. Packed with protein-rich quinoa, fiber-filled black beans, and a rainbow of vegetables, they’re a nutritious and flavorful option which are also really filling. And they’re great for a dinner party too!

If you haven’t hopped on the quinoa train yet, now’s the time. This ancient grain is a bit of a superhero in the world of nutrition – packed with protein, fiber, and a whole bunch of essential vitamins and minerals. It’s also a complete protein source, meaning it has all the essential amino acids.

Then there’s the bell peppers. In this recipe, they not only add a pop of color to your plate but also bring a sweet, tangy flavor that perfectly complements the earthiness of quinoa. Talk about a power duo! Plus, they’re incredibly easy to make – just stuff the peppers with the filling, pop them in the oven, and let them bake until tender.

2. Black Bean Tacos

Beans are a fantastic source of plant-based protein, and black beans are no exception. In this recipe, mashed black beans with spices like cumin, chili powder, and paprika create a flavorful filling for tacos.

You can always freestyle with the toppings and choose whatever your heart desires but we recommend loading up some shredded lettuce, diced tomatoes, avocado slices, and a dollop of tangy salsa with the black bean mixture! These tacos are sure to be a hit with vegetarians and meat-eaters alike.

3. Quinoa Salad with Chickpeas and Avocado

Whether you’re looking for a light and refreshing lunch, a satisfying side dish, or a wholesome dinner option, this Quinoa Salad with Chickpeas and Avocado recipe has got you covered. It’s hearty enough to keep you full and satisfied, yet light enough to leave you feeling energized and nourished. Plus, it’s a great make-ahead option for meal prep – simply store it in the fridge and enjoy it throughout the week. The best part? This salad comes together in no time! You can toss everything together in a big bowl with your favorite dressing – whether it’s a tangy vinaigrette, creamy tahini, or a simple squeeze of lemon juice. Voila! You’ve got yourself a delicious and nutritious meal that’s perfect for lunch, dinner, or any time in between.

4. Lentil Bolognese

Who needs ground beef when you have lentils? Lentil Bolognese takes everything we love about the traditional meat-based sauce and gives it a plant-based makeover. Instead of ground beef or pork, this version features hearty lentils as the star ingredient. Not only do lentils provide a satisfying texture similar to meat, but they’re also packed with protein, fiber, and a host of essential nutrients. Plus, they’re budget-friendly and easy to cook – making them a pantry staple for many households.

Hopefully now that you’re craving a big bowl of Lentil Bolognese- this simple yet plant-powered Lentil Bolognese recipe is sure going to become a new favorite in your recipe repertoire.

5. Tofu Stir-Fry

Are you in the mood for a delicious and nutritious meal that’s quick and easy to make? Look no further than tofu stir fry! This versatile tofu recipe is a favorite among both vegans and omnivores alike. Its what veggie dreams are made of: a sizzling hot skillet, filled to the brim with hearty tofu, crunchy veggies, and no shortage of mouthwatering spices.

Tofu is also a really versatile addition to a vegetarian diet thanks to its ability to take on the flavor of so many different dishes. It’s another complete protein, so is great for muscle synthesis and for keeping you full.

6. Black Bean Quinoa Burgers

No need to miss out on burger night just because you’re not eating meat, thanks to these black bean quinoa burgers! These hearty patties are a delicious alternative to traditional beef burgers, offering wholesome ingredients that will leave you feeling nourished as well as super-satisfied.

Black beans are loaded with protein, fiber, and essential vitamins and minerals, while quinoa provides a complete source of protein and a host of other nutrients. And let’s not forget about the crunchy outside, and softer center. Seriously, they’ll satisfy even the pickiest eaters.

7. Spinach and Feta Frittata

Spinach and feta frittata is the ultimate brunch hero. It’s like a savory pie meets an omelet – a delightful mashup of creamy eggs, earthy spinach, and tangy feta cheese. And eggs are always a winner when it comes to anything breakfast or brunch.

What we love is that the richness of eggs perfectly complementing the salty tang of the feta and the freshness of the spinach. Plus, it packs a nutrition punch and is nice and filling too. And it makes a great office lunch the next day as well, whether you serve it hot or cold. Make one in advance and eat it all week!

8. Peanut Tofu Buddha Bowl

This Peanut Tofu Buddha Bowl recipe is for all the tofu lovers, peanut sauce aficionados, or anyone who enjoys a hearty and protein packed meal which feels like it couyld have come straight from the streets of Thailand.

This Peanut Tofu Buddha Bowl recipe has all the good stuff: crunchy tofu, crisp vegetables and avocado are all brought together with a creamy peanut sauce. It’s a great balance of flavors, including savory, nutty and creamy. And obviously, we have to talk about the nutrition value too. This is the kind of lunch or dinner you can eat as post-workout fuel, a jealousy-inducing office meal, or even just a family dinner on the seriously healthy side. Brimming with protein, fiber, and essential nutrients, this Buddha bowl ticks all the boxes!